COUNTY’S TOP SCIENTISTS SHOWCASE KNOWLEDGE AND COMPETE FOR SPOT AT INTERNATIONAL SCIENCE FAIR

More than 400 secondary students from public and private schools will share their research in the disciplines of science, math, and engineering at the Anne Arundel County Public Schools Regional Science and Engineering Expo at North County High School on March 3, 2018.

Hundreds of awards, prizes, and incentives have been provided by organizations such as Educational Systems Federal Credit Union, Defense Spectrum Organization, Anne Arundel Community College, Intel, US Air Force, the US Navy/US Marine Corps Office of Naval Research, and the Water Environment Federation. The Grand Prize winner(s) will have the opportunity to compete at the Intel International Science and Engineering Fair (Intel ISEF) in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ania in May 2018. More than $4 million in awards and scholarships will be awarded at Intel ISEF.

Students will discuss their research and communicate their findings with judges from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. on March 3, 2018, at North County High School. Research projects will be available for public viewing from 9 a.m. to 10 a.m.

Winners of the regional expo will be announced during the awards ceremony on March 8, 2018, from 6 to 8:30 p.m. at North County High School. The expo and awards ceremony are open to the public.
